Several solutions:

Reward proper behavior - Punish improper behavior.

ACCIDENTS during wartime can & DID happen, and the level of simulation of wartime in a game is determined by the amount of realism built into the game.

EXCUSES - can be avoided by developing a training area which acts as a sort of basic training to be completed before allowing the player into the actual fire zone consisting of identification training, ship/sub controls testing, and target practice. This forces a player to spend enough time learning the game to be unable to make false claims in case they have not practiced prior to jumping into multiplayer.

Designing a game with accidental friendly fire is a difficult choice to make because:

Proving and Determining the intentions of a player is time consuming and difficult due to the myriad of possibilities in a tactical situation with torpedos and bullets flying all around.

1) Disable Friendly Fire: (no realism at all in this regard - highest probability to avoid having "griefers" in your gameworld - but also lose the interest of "purists" in the sense of simulation levels)

2) Friendly Fire may only damage the person who fired and generates no visual feedback to the "griefer" to avoid giving visual stimulation to repeat the offense (punishment, but not realistic - some players actually want to have a reward/punishment system to feel more challenge to playing properly)

3) Friendly Fire hits and generates smoke/explosion, but causes no damage to ally (reduced realism- may also damage the person who fired to some degree for punishment)

4) Friendly Fire hits but causes limited damage to ally (reduced realism - may also damage the person who fired to some degree for punishment - causes concern for player taking damage, and the rest of his loyal team mates)

5) Friendly Fire hits and causes full damage to ally (full realism - greatest possibility for concern among the players from same nation - greatest punishment deserved in this case, possibility of losing the ability to spawn in ANY vessel with firepower from ANY nation for various amounts of time.

Players credit card/other payment method attached to game name to be recorded, researched, cross-referenced, and punished by banning for repeat offenses. Repeat offenders can change their game name or payment method, but they will still have to earn their place all over again. They will have limited opportunity to become repeat offenders.

The amount of time required to devote to "griefing", choosing new payment methods, names, rank, can be a very successful deterrent as the punishment time can be increased substantially.

In each case the offending player would be knocked down in prestige or ability to captain a ship on his next run and may have to earn his way back to spawning anything with firepower on the nation where he committed the offense.. enough "accidents" and that player would have to wait a very long time to participate in that same nation again, if ever.
